1. Why Consistency is the Secret to Success
Imagine planting a seed. If you water it daily, give it sunlight, and take care of it, it will grow into a strong tree. But if you stop halfway, it withers. Your online business works the same way!
Here’s why consistency matters:
✅ Builds trust and authority – People buy from those they trust.
✅ Improves skills over time – Repetition makes you better at what you do.
✅ Increases visibility – Regular content and engagement keep you relevant.
✅ Leads to long-term income – Small efforts compound into big results.
How to Stay Consistent in Your Online Business
- Set realistic goals – Instead of aiming for $10,000 overnight, focus on steady progress.
- Create a schedule – Whether it’s posting content, engaging on social media, or improving your website, stay committed to a routine.
- Track your progress – Monitor what’s working and adjust as needed.
2. The Power of Lifelong Learning
The online world changes rapidly. What worked last year might not work today. To stay ahead, you must keep learning and adapting.
Ways to Keep Learning and Improving
📚 Read books & articles – Stay updated with industry trends.
🎓 Take online courses – Platforms like Udemy, Coursera, and Skillshare offer valuable training.
🎙 Follow successful entrepreneurs – Watch their YouTube videos, listen to podcasts, and read their blogs.
🛠 Experiment & test – The best way to learn is by doing. Try new strategies and see what works best.
🤝 Join communities – Being part of mastermind groups or online communities keeps you motivated and informed.
3. Overcoming Challenges and Staying Motivated
Every successful entrepreneur has faced setbacks. What makes them different is their ability to push through difficulties and keep going.
Common Challenges & How to Overcome Them
🚧 Lack of Motivation? → Remember your “why” – Whether it’s financial freedom or creating a better future, stay connected to your purpose.
🚧 Slow Progress? → Focus on small wins – Celebrate every step forward, no matter how small.
🚧 Fear of Failure? → See failure as feedback – Every mistake is a lesson, not a dead end.
